Hey! Want to know what the new year 2025 has for you via your driver number? You are at the right place. Numerologist Rakhhi Jain knows about cosmic influences that shape our lives through. How? Well, because 2025 is a sum of 9 (2 + 0 + 2 + 5 = 9) and in numerology, Mars (Mangal) rules the number 9. Mars is the energy of action and achievement. And yet, it is also the planet of Lord Hanuman in Indian spiritual life, a symbol of courage, devotion and power.
Driver Number 1 (Born on the 1st, 10th, 19th or 28th): People with this number are born under the influence of the Sun, the king of planets. Their core strengths would be leadership and confidence and opportunities await them in 2025. Everything ranging from office to love life and personal life will give them immense opportunities for developing leadership skills and achieving great success.
Career: Recognise time and chances to promote or start new projects or become a business owner. Such individuals will simply shine and stand out as automatic leaders as people like them.
Challenges: The Sun can sometimes make them headstrong or overconfident. They must be humble and keep themselves in check so that they don't enter into conflicts.
Action plan: They must start their mornings by performing 'abhisheka' of water to the Sun god at sunrise. That's a beautiful daily routine to connect to solar energy. They should recite the 'Gayatri Mantra' for complete clarity and strength in their inner self. Also, wear yellow, gold-coloured clothes to add good vibes.
Driver Number 2 (Born on the 2nd, 11th, 20th or 29th): Such people are ruled by the Moon, the planet of emotions and intuition. They are deeply creative and sensitive. In 2025, those very qualities will really help to navigate life beautifully. It's going to be a year of emotional balance and beautiful creative breakthroughs.
